首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Windows 10上的Docker Desktop在切换到Windows容器时崩溃

可能是由于以下原因导致的:

  1. 系统兼容性问题:Docker Desktop可能与Windows 10的某些版本或更新存在兼容性问题,导致切换到Windows容器时崩溃。建议升级到最新版本的Windows 10,并确保安装了最新的Docker Desktop版本。
  2. 资源限制:Windows容器可能需要更多的系统资源来运行,如果系统资源不足,Docker Desktop可能会崩溃。建议关闭其他占用大量资源的应用程序,并尝试重新启动Docker Desktop。
  3. 容器配置错误:Docker容器的配置可能存在问题,导致切换到Windows容器时崩溃。建议检查Docker容器的配置文件,确保配置正确,并尝试重新启动Docker Desktop。
  4. Docker Desktop安装问题:Docker Desktop的安装可能存在问题,导致切换到Windows容器时崩溃。建议卸载并重新安装Docker Desktop,并确保按照官方文档的指导进行正确的安装步骤。

对于解决这个问题,可以尝试以下步骤:

  1. 更新系统和Docker Desktop:确保Windows 10和Docker Desktop都是最新版本,并且已经安装了所有的更新补丁。
  2. 检查系统资源:关闭其他占用大量资源的应用程序,释放系统资源,尝试重新启动Docker Desktop。
  3. 检查容器配置:检查Docker容器的配置文件,确保配置正确,没有错误的参数或配置项。
  4. 重新安装Docker Desktop:卸载并重新安装Docker Desktop,按照官方文档的指导进行正确的安装步骤。

如果问题仍然存在,建议查看Docker Desktop的日志文件,以获取更多详细的错误信息,并将问题报告给Docker官方支持渠道,以获取进一步的帮助和解决方案。

腾讯云提供了一系列与容器相关的产品和服务,例如腾讯云容器服务(Tencent Kubernetes Engine,TKE),它是一种高度可扩展的容器管理服务,可帮助用户轻松部署、管理和扩展容器化应用。您可以通过以下链接了解更多关于腾讯云容器服务的信息:https://cloud.tencent.com/product/tke

请注意,以上答案仅供参考,具体解决方案可能因个人情况而异。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Windows系统Linux容器

Windows运行Docker,只需要一个很小Linux内核和用户空间来承载容器进程。这正是LinuxKit工具包设计初衷——创建安全、精简、可移植Linux子系统。...使用LinuxKitWindows运行Docker 以下操作已经Windows 10”和“Windows Server Insider build 16278和16281“版本中进行了测试。...届时,开发人员就能够同一系统同时运行两个平台容器,更轻松地构建、测试混合在Windows / Linux 两个操作系统中Docker应用程序。...譬如,Windows系统Docker,将使Windows 服务器Docker企业版和可视化管理界面(依赖某些Linux独占组件)设置步骤变得更加简单。...更多资源 下载Docker for Windows 10Docker for Windows Serve 了解有关Docker企业版更多信息 加入“Windows使用Docker容器和LinuxKit

4.9K60

Windows 做开发还能这么爽?WSL + VS Code + Docker Desktop 你值得有用

直到 WSL 到来,准确来说是 WSL2。 WSL + VS Code + Docker Desktop 这三剑客组合,开始让我觉得 Windows 做开发是一件非常爽事情。...什么是 WSL WSL 是 Windows Subsystem for Linux 缩写,它是 Windows 10 操作系统一项功能,使你能够 Windows 直接运行 Linux 文件系统,...WSL 最低版本要求是 Windows 10 version 1903 及更高。...最最重要是,使用 WSL 结合 VS Code + Docker 既有 Linux 完美体验感,也同时拥有 Windows 办公生产力,这是虚拟机或是 Linux 操作系统所办不到,Mac 可以但并不是所有人都适合...,如果需要在 WSL 中使用 Docker,需要在 Windows 预先安装 Docker Desktop[3]。

2.6K40

Docker极简教程》--Docker环境搭建-Windows搭建Docker环境

Docker是一种开源容器化平台,它可以帮助开发人员更轻松地构建、发布和运行应用程序。Windows搭建Docker环境,可以提供一个可靠容器化开发和部署平台。...一、步骤 Windows搭建Docker环境步骤如下: 安装Docker DesktopDocker Desktop是适用于WindowsDocker桌面应用程序,集成了Docker引擎、命令行工具和...二、注意事项 Windows搭建Docker环境,需要注意以下事项: 系统要求:Windows版本需要满足一些要求,如Windows 10 64位专业版、企业版或教育版(Build 15063或更高版本...容器网络设置:Windows安装DockerDocker会创建一个默认虚拟网络,并将容器连接到该网络。...以下是一些常见问题及解决方法: 容器无法访问主机上服务:当在Windows安装Docker并创建容器,默认情况下,容器无法访问主机上服务。

46500

彻底解决dockerwindows端口绑定问题

我相信不少开发者正在或曾经使用 docker 起后端开发环境,那么肯定有不少人遇到过这个莫名奇妙错误: Error invoking remote method ‘docker-start-container...错误解决方案 来自 StackOverflow 错误解决方案 该问题高赞回答中,他使用了以下命令: net stop winnat docker start container_name net... Windows Vista(或 Windows Server 2008)之前,动态端口范围是 1025 到 5000;在其之后版本中,新默认起始端口为 49152,新默认结束端口为 65535...如果安装了 Hyper-V,则 Hyper-V 会保留一些随机端口号供 Windows 容器主机网络服务使用。...但是 Windows 自动更新有时会出错(万恶自动更新),把“TCP 动态端口范围”起始端口被重置为 1024,导致 Hyper-V 预留端口时候占用了常用端口号,使得一些常用端口因为被预留而无法使用

5.3K20

LinuxWindows子系统(WSL)使用Docker(Ubuntu)

今天Windows中,当您运行Windows Server容器,守护进程Windows中运行。当您切换到Linux容器模式,守护程序实际名为Moby Linux VM虚拟机内运行。...随着Docker 即将发布,您将能够并行运行Windows Server容器和Linux容器,守护进程将始终作为Windows进程运行。 然而,客户端不必与守护进程安装在同一个地方。...配置WSL 我们需要在WSL安装Docker客户端 执行命令:apt installdocker.io 将WSL配置为连接到Docker for Windows 执行命令:export DOCKER_HOST...=tcp://127.0.0.1:2375 这步骤很重要,例如利用gitlabrunnergitlab-ci.yml中也需要有次命令,runner镜像才可连接宿主机Docker进行构建作业!...打开这两个文件中有数据那个并在结尾处添加 保存后重新启动bash控制台执行docker相关命令可以照常执行了 由于windows10推出生产力又进一步释放,绝大部分开发人员还是继续会在windows

3.5K20

Linux Lite 5.4 可以 PC 替代 Windows 10

实际,它们都非常好。话虽如此,Windows 10最新版本存在许多错误。不幸是,由于不再支持Windows 7,因此许多用户很难做出决定。...他们必须决定是使用不受支持Windows 7还是升级到Windows 10Windows 10包括一个遥测服务,可以将关于您计算机诊断和使用数据自动发送给Microsoft,这是一个非常困难决定...值得庆幸是,有一个更好选择-只需切换到Linux!...是的,将支持现代基于Linux操作系统(与现在已经过时Windows 7不同),并且大多数将在老化硬件运行(与Windows 10不同)。...底层,Linux Lite 5.4由Ubuntu 20.04.2 LTS(Focal Fossa)长期支持Linux 5.4内核系列提供支持。

3K20

Windows10安装Docker遇到问题解决方法

Windows 安装Docker是一个相当简单和直接过程,之前接触Docker Centos 系统下, Windows 下并没有尝试过 我司项目一直在用Docker,我我司用电脑也是...Windows10,其他人基本都是 Mac,入职时候我是按照内部 Wiki建环境,使用VirtualBox和vagrant 不过现在有一个新项目,所以还是尝试一下使用Docker,同时为了自己笔记本假期练习或者修改...可以支持 Mac、Windows、Linux 安装,但是 Windows10 系统中Docker for Windows目前只能在 64 位 Windows10 专业版、企业版、教育版下才能安装...,Win7/Win8/Win10 家庭版需要通过Docker Toolbox来安装,我电脑是家庭版,却要安装Docker for Windows 2、安装了 Hyper-V Windows 安装...原创文章采用CC BY-NC-SA 4.0协议进行许可,转载请注明:转载自:Windows10安装Docker遇到问题解决方法

52.8K5939

【愚公系列】2022年05月 Docker容器 Windows11ElasticSearch安装

文章目录 前言 1.WSL2 一、ElasticSearch安装 1.Docker Desktop 2.运行容器 3.安装可视化软件ElasticHD 4.es跨域问题 前言 要在Windows安装MongoDB...WSL2 允许您在 Windows 本地运行 Linux 二进制文件。要使此方法正常工作,你需要运行 Windows 10 版本 2004 及更高版本或 Windows 11。...1.WSL2 WSL 2 是适用于 Linux Windows 子系统体系结构一个新版本,它支持适用于 Linux Windows 子系统 Windows 运行 ELF64 Linux 二进制文件...一、ElasticSearch安装 1.Docker Desktop docker pull elasticsearch:7.17.1 2.运行容器 docker run -d --name es7...ps docker exec -ti 容器id /bin/bash /usr/share/elasticsearch# find ./ -name elasticsearch.yml /usr/share

1.2K30

【愚公系列】2022年05月 Docker容器 Windows11Redis安装

WSL2 允许您在 Windows 本地运行 Linux 二进制文件。要使此方法正常工作,你需要运行 Windows 10 版本 2004 及更高版本或 Windows 11。...1.WSL2 WSL 2 是适用于 Linux Windows 子系统体系结构一个新版本,它支持适用于 Linux Windows 子系统 Windows 运行 ELF64 Linux 二进制文件...一、Redis安装 1.Docker Desktop docker pull redis 2.设置配置文件 E盘创建两个文件夹: conf目录用于挂载配置文件 data目录用于存放数据持久化文件 .../redis_6379.conf 把宿主机配置好redis.conf放到容器这个位置中 -v /D/docker/redis/data:/data/ 把redis持久化数据宿主机内显示,做数据备份...安装最新最新Redis先有wsl2子系统,子系统安装Docker Desktop配置wls2,后就可以命令行打开ubuntu系统进行docker操作。

2.9K50

【愚公系列】2022年05月 Docker容器 Windows11MongoDB安装

文章目录 前言 1.WSL2 一、MongoDB安装 1.Docker Desktop 2.运行容器 3.设置账号密码 4.navicat连接mogodb 前言 要在Windows安装MongoDB...WSL2 允许您在 Windows 本地运行 Linux 二进制文件。要使此方法正常工作,你需要运行 Windows 10 版本 2004 及更高版本或 Windows 11。...1.WSL2 WSL 2 是适用于 Linux Windows 子系统体系结构一个新版本,它支持适用于 Linux Windows 子系统 Windows 运行 ELF64 Linux 二进制文件...一、MongoDB安装 1.Docker Desktop docker pull mongo 2.运行容器 docker run -itd --name mongo -p 27017:27017 mongo...--auth 参数说明: -p 27017:27017 :映射容器服务 27017 端口到宿主机 27017 端口。

1.4K30

ASP.NET Core on K8S学习初探(1)K8S单节点环境搭建

Core on K8S学习初探:Docker for Windows中搭建单节点环境,初步了解有个感性认识 ASP.NET Core on K8S深入学习:Linux搭建K8S集群,对K8S一些核心概念有个深入认识...总体来说,就是Docker容器技术被炒得热火朝天之时,大家发现,如果想要将Docker应用于具体业务实现,是存在困难——编排、管理和调度等各个方面,都不容易。...K8S环境搭建在Windows和Linux下,还可以基于云服务提供商封装好K8S服务进行快速构建,这里为了快速玩玩,选择了Windows下基于Docker for Windows来进行。...二、安装核心步骤 2.1 前置条件   确保当前Windows环境有以下几个关键点: Windows 10 PRO专业版及以上 Hyper-V 虚拟机 Docker for Windows,这里演示是...cd k8s-for-docker-desktop   这里,为了匹配18.06版本(Docker CE版本号或者你Docker for Windows版本号),切换到该项目的18.09分支。

95540

ASP.NET Core on K8S学习初探(1)

Core on K8S学习初探:Docker for Windows中搭建单节点环境,初步了解有个感性认识 2、ASP.NET Core on K8S深入学习:Linux搭建K8S集群,对K8S...总体来说,就是Docker容器技术被炒得热火朝天之时,大家发现,如果想要将Docker应用于具体业务实现,是存在困难——编排、管理和调度等各个方面,都不容易。...K8S环境搭建在Windows和Linux下,还可以基于云服务提供商封装好K8S服务进行快速构建,这里为了快速玩玩,选择了Windows下基于Docker for Windows来进行。...03搭建步骤 2.1 前置条件 确保当前Windows环境有以下几个关键点: Windows 10 PRO专业版及以上 Hyper-V 虚拟机 Docker for Windows,这里演示Docker...cd k8s-for-docker-desktop   这里,为了匹配18.06版本(Docker CE版本号或者你Docker for Windows版本号),切换到该项目的18.09分支。

75150

ASP.NET Core on K8S学习初探(1)K8S单节点环境搭建

Core on K8S学习初探:Docker for Windows中搭建单节点环境,初步了解有个感性认识 ASP.NET Core on K8S深入学习:Linux搭建K8S集群,对K8S一些核心概念有个深入认识...总体来说,就是Docker容器技术被炒得热火朝天之时,大家发现,如果想要将Docker应用于具体业务实现,是存在困难——编排、管理和调度等各个方面,都不容易。...K8S环境搭建在Windows和Linux下,还可以基于云服务提供商封装好K8S服务进行快速构建,这里为了快速玩玩,选择了Windows下基于Docker for Windows来进行。...二、安装核心步骤 2.1 前置条件   确保当前Windows环境有以下几个关键点: Windows 10 PRO专业版及以上 Hyper-V 虚拟机 Docker for Windows,这里演示是...cd k8s-for-docker-desktop   这里,为了匹配18.06版本(Docker CE版本号或者你Docker for Windows版本号),切换到该项目的18.09分支。

69030

2024程序员容器云之旅-第2集-Windows11版:接近深洞

他有一台旧Windows 10笔记本电脑。i54核CPU。 原本内存是8GB,后来维修中心将其扩展到了20GB。 但跑起程序来,还是感觉慢。...他从资料中了解到,容器时代,如果想使用数据库及其管理工具,完全可以从Docker hub,下载对应docker image文件。...4.1.1 安装docker desktop ✅马意浓docker官网上,找到了docker desktop for Windows安装方法。 他按图索骥,安装好。...再根据提示重启电脑,并用自己docker hub账号登录docker desktop。 他看到所安装docker desktop for windows版本是v4.27.1(136059)。...等到屏幕显示两个容器都启动了,他切换到docker desktop界面,看到两个容器都启动后界面。如图2。

28642
领券